Overview
11SMnPb30
1.0718
Leaded free-cutting steel — the highest machinability rating among carbon steels. Pb+S combination gives excellent chip breaking and surface finish. The standard grade for high-volume automatic lathe parts. Used for screws, nuts, bolts, bushings, pins, and automotive turned parts. ≈ AISI 12L14.
C10E
1.1121
Lowest practical carbon case-hardening steel — 0.07-0.13% C. After carburizing: hard surface (HRC 55-60) with extremely soft, tough core (HRC 15-20). Maximum impact absorption. Modern designation for Ck10. Used for pins, bushings, small gears, camshaft lobes, and any carburized part where maximum core toughness and ductility are critical. Also used as cold-heading and deep-drawing wire/strip.
| 11SMnPb30 | C10E | |
|---|---|---|
| Material Number | 1.0718 | 1.1121 |
| Category | Carbon Steel | Carbon Steel |
| Standard | EN 10087 | EN 10084 |
Chemical composition (wt%)
| Element | 11SMnPb30 | C10E | Overlap |
|---|---|---|---|
| C | 0–0.14% | 0.07–0.13% | OK |
| Si | 0–0.05% | 0–0.4% | OK |
| Mn | 0.9–1.3% | 0.3–0.6% | No overlap |
| P | 0–0.11% | 0–0.025% | OK |
Mechanical properties
| Property | 11SMnPb30 | C10E | Unit |
|---|---|---|---|
| tensile_strength | 460–710 | 310–440 | MPa |
| yield_strength | ≥ 375 | 180–220 | MPa |
| elongation | ≥ 8 | 28–35 | % |
